Designing a City of the Future

Thursday, March 22nd 12pm-2pm
80 5th Avenue room 802
Aseem Inam, Director of the Theories of Urban Practice Program and Associate Professor of Urbanism at Parsons The New School for Design, will talk about what it means to design a city of the future.  He will discuss the unique case study of designing a city on the U.S.-Mexico border, for which he was the project leader.  The talk is free and open to the public.
